Givenchy, founded in 1952 by Hubert de Givenchy, is a renowned French luxury fashion house celebrated for its haute couture, ready-to-wear collections, accessories, and fragrances. The brand is named after its founder, who was a protégé of Cristóbal Balenciaga and a close collaborator with Audrey Hepburn, dressing her in iconic films like "Breakfast at Tiffany's." Givenchy is known for its elegant, sophisticated designs, blending classic French craftsmanship with modern innovation. Over the years, the brand has expanded its offerings to include men's and women's fashion, leather goods, and beauty products, maintaining its status as a symbol of timeless luxury and refinement. Since 1988, Givenchy has been part of the LVMH (Moët Hennessy Louis Vuitton) group, continuing to influence global fashion trends.
